Surgery this weekend

Hi, I've been reading posts on here for the past couple of months, as I have prepared for my own banding surgery... just decided to register today, so I could post.

My wife and I are getting banded on the same day (Dec. 19th), and are currently on the pre-op diet. Learning how to eat all over again. We have already attended an information seminar and a nutrition class, so a lot of my questions have been answered. But, I always seem to come up with more... lol.

Just waiting now... nervous and excited... never had any kind of surgery before, so that part is a little scary.

thanks, everyone, for your support... we made it through... my wife had some nausea issues immediately after surgery, but they seemed to have dissipated...

as for me, the Dr. also fixed a hiatal hernia I didn't even know I had... I feel pretty good... sore and gassy, as you would expect... we've started walking to help out with both of those... but, we're taking it slow...

also, we started our Phase 2 diet today... full liquids and Protein shakes...

including the pre-op diet, I'm down 10 lbs. in 10 days... not too bad!
